We are looking for an experienced Program Manager to oversee customer-facing aerospace programs in Arlington, Washington. This role partners closely with internal teams and external customers to keep production commitments on track, address issues quickly, and support reliable delivery performance. The ideal candidate brings strong supply chain and program management experience, sound business judgment, and the ability to lead through shifting priorities in a deadline-driven environment.


Responsibilities:

• Serve as the primary point of contact for assigned customers, maintaining clear communication on program status, priorities, and delivery expectations.

• Direct the progress of production orders from initial planning through shipment, making informed decisions to support schedule performance and operational goals.

• Respond to urgent customer concerns with professionalism and sound judgment, including situations that may require attention beyond standard working hours.

• Lead formal program reviews, presenting updates, risks, action plans, and performance outcomes to customer stakeholders and internal leadership.

• Develop and drive corrective action plans when products fall behind customer requirements, working across functions to recover schedule commitments.

• Coordinate responses to engineering changes, balancing customer needs with cost considerations and overall program impact.

• Negotiate key commercial and operational matters such as spare parts pricing, lead times, and expedited service requests.

• Analyze demand patterns and industry factors to improve forecast visibility and provide accurate shipment date commitments.

• Support a safe working environment by following company safety practices and reinforcing compliance with applicable procedures.

• Carry out additional program-related duties as needed to support customer satisfaction and business objectives.

Qualifications:

• Demonstrated experience managing programs, supply chain activities, or customer accounts within an aerospace manufacturing environment.
• Strong ability to communicate effectively and coordinate across teams in a fast-moving setting with changing priorities and tight deadlines.
• Proven capability to work independently, make sound decisions, and maintain momentum with limited supervision.
• High attention to detail and ethical standards when working with customers, suppliers, and internal partners.
• Background in forecasting, logistics, production order oversight, or related supply chain management functions.
• Proficiency with business systems and tools such as Microsoft Excel and ERP platforms, including SyteLine or Epicor.
• Experience supporting negotiations related to pricing, lead times, delivery commitments, or expedited requests.
• Record of success in a high-performing program management environment, including sustained contribution in a tier-one or similarly demanding role.
